Tendon reconstruction for postburn boutonnière deformity

Summary
A new surgical technique uses tendon grafts to reconstruct the proximal interphalangeal joint hood, effectively correcting postburn boutonnière deformity by utilizing lateral bands for finger extension.

Background:
- Postburn boutonnière deformity significantly impairs hand function.
- Current reconstructive methods for this deformity have limitations.
- Proximal interphalangeal joint (PIPJ) instability is a key challenge.
Purpose of the Study:
- To describe a novel surgical procedure for boutonnière deformity correction.
- To reconstruct the PIPJ hood using a tendon graft.
- To leverage lateral band function for simultaneous interphalangeal joint extension.
Main Methods:
- A surgical technique involving tendon graft reconstruction of the PIPJ hood.
- Focus on utilizing the intrinsic lateral bands of the fingers.
- Procedure applied to 22 fingers across multiple patients.
Main Results:
- Satisfactory functional and aesthetic outcomes were achieved in most cases.
- The technique successfully achieved simultaneous extension of the interphalangeal joints.
- Avoidance of excessive palmar displacement of the lateral bands was noted.
Conclusions:
- This tendon graft reconstruction technique offers a viable solution for postburn boutonnière deformity.
- The method effectively restores PIPJ stability and finger extension.
- The technique showed limitations in the small finger, warranting further investigation.
